COSIT200
Electromagnetic Sieve Shaker · 3D Particle Motion · Dry/Wet Sieving
COSIT200 sieve shaker for particle size testing with combined vertical and horizontal vibration to create effective three-dimensional particle motion. Designed for reliable granulometric separation in QC and R&D, supporting dry or wet sieving workflows. Adjustable timer (1–99 min) with continuous or interval work cycles; robust 450 W drive and support for multiple sieve heights and diameters. General & performance specifications

instrument identity
instrument typeCOSIT200 sieve shaker
working principleElectromagnetic, compact drive
applicationGranulometric separation / particle size testing
type of sievingDry / Wet
sieving range & motion
range of sieving20 µm to 125 mm
particle motionThree-dimensional (3D)
dynamic of sieving3000 vibrations per minute
maximum vibration amplitude3 mm
time control
timer1 to 99 minutes
work cycleContinuous / discontinuous (interval mode with 10 s intervals)
sieve stack capacity
maximum number of sieves 8 (Ø 200/203 × 50 mm high)
15 (Ø 200/203 × 25 mm high)
sieve diameter compatibility60 to 203 mm
electrical & physical
voltage230 V · 50/60 Hz
power450 W
dimensions (W × D × H)400 × 320 × 135 mm
gross / net weight32 / 27 kg
options (selected)
user interface optionOptional 5″ LCD color touch screen

Operation overview

loading Place the sample on the top sieve of a stacked set with progressively smaller openings.
run Set time (1–99 min) and select continuous or interval mode; start the shaker.
analysis After the run, weigh retained fractions on each sieve to calculate PSD (mass % by fraction).
wet sieving Use wet method for cohesive/fine materials where dispersion improves separation and reduces blinding.

Practical notes for reliable PSD results

topicrecommendationnote
sample mass Use a consistent sample mass and avoid overloading the sieve mesh. Overloading reduces separation efficiency and increases variability.
sieving time Keep sieving time consistent (timer 1–99 min) and validate a standard method for each material. Too short: incomplete separation; too long: potential attrition for fragile particles.
interval mode Use discontinuous mode (10 s intervals) for cohesive or blinding-prone materials. Intervals can help redistribution and reduce mesh blocking.
wet sieving Apply wet sieving where dispersion is needed for fine/cohesive powders. Ensure compatibility of sample with the chosen liquid and sieve material.
sieve maintenance Clean sieves after each run and inspect mesh condition regularly. Damaged meshes or residual deposits distort PSD results.
